What is port 2571?
Port 2571/TCP is a Registered port, registered with IANA for specific applications. It is associated with the cecsvc service.

Is it safe to expose port 2571 to the Internet?
It depends on the service and configuration. Port 2571 (cecsvc) is a Registered port. If you need to expose it, keep the service updated, use strong authentication, and configure a firewall. It's always recommended to restrict access by IP when possible.
How do I check if port 2571 is open?
You can use nmap: `nmap -p 2571 -sV example.com`, netcat: `nc -zv example.com 2571`, or the bash command: `(echo > /dev/tcp/example.com/2571) 2>/dev/null && echo "Open" || echo "Closed"`.
How do I open or close port 2571 on my firewall?
On Linux with UFW: `sudo ufw allow 2571/tcp` (open) or `sudo ufw deny 2571/tcp` (close). With iptables: `sudo iptables -A INPUT -p tcp --dport 2571 -j ACCEPT`. On Windows: `netsh advfirewall firewall add rule name="Open Port 2571" dir=in action=allow protocol=TCP localport=2571`.
